Modus investigate mural

Modus is organising further investigations into the chartist mural, in Newport city centre, before finalising the decision to relocate the mosaic. The developers will be removing parts of the artwork to do further tests to determine whether it will be possible to re-locate it.
 
The Chartist Mural will either be relocated or replaced by Modus, who understand the importance of the commemorative mosaic to the Newport community. The public will be fully involved in every step of the progress, and will be asked to contribute their thoughts should a new piece of artwork need to be created.

Modus are creating a development that will completely revitalise the city. The scheme will provide 475,000 sq ft of retail as well as 250 city style apartments, 47,000 sq ft multi screen cinemas, public space and a cafes and restaurants quarter
 
Friars Walk will be anchored by a 105,000 sq. ft. Debenhams.

The build is due to start on site i spring 2008 and the anticipated completion date is late 2009.

 latest news- the most recent suggestion has now been that the mural is created from new, using the allocated public art money available for the Modus schemes. The original designs are held on paper and can be recreated.
